316 Stainless Steel Phillips Truss Head Sheet Metal Screws

What are 316 Stainless Steel Phillips Truss Head Sheet Metal Screws? 316 stainless steel Phillips truss head sheet metal screws are self-tapping screws with a Phillips drive, marine grade stainless steel construction, and a wide low-profile truss head that provides a larger bearing surface than many smaller head styles. They are commonly used to fasten sheet metal, plastic, wood, fiberglass, brackets, panels, covers, and light-gauge materials where the screw needs to form or cut its own mating threads during installation.

Why Choose 316 Stainless Steel Phillips Truss Head Sheet Metal Screws?

316 stainless steel Phillips truss head sheet metal screws are a strong choice when an application needs a self-tapping screw with extra corrosion resistance and a broad, low-profile head. The 316 stainless steel construction is commonly selected for marine, coastal, wet, chemical, outdoor, and other corrosive environments where standard steel or general-purpose stainless fasteners may not be the best fit.

The wide truss head helps spread clamping pressure across the material, making these screws useful for panels, covers, brackets, and thin materials. The Phillips drive works with common screwdrivers and driver bits, making them practical for assembly, repair, and maintenance applications.

Common Uses for 316 Stainless Steel Truss Head Sheet Metal Screws

These screws are commonly used for sheet metal panels, brackets, covers, fixtures, enclosures, marine hardware, outdoor equipment, HVAC work, appliance repair, automotive trim, plastic components, fiberglass, wood, and general maintenance applications.

316 stainless steel is often preferred for coastal, marine, wet, chemical, and corrosive environments. For general indoor or less corrosive outdoor applications, 18-8 stainless steel may also be suitable depending on the project requirements.

Truss Head and Phillips Drive Benefits

Truss head sheet metal screws have a wide, slightly rounded head that provides a larger bearing surface than many standard screw head styles. This can be helpful when fastening thin material or when the screw head needs to cover a larger area.

The Phillips drive is widely used and easy to match with common tools. For harder materials or production work, make sure the driver bit is seated properly to reduce slipping during installation.

How to Choose the Right Size

Choose a screw diameter and length based on the material thickness, holding strength needed, and available clearance behind the workpiece. The screw should be long enough to create secure thread engagement without protruding too far through the back side of the assembly.

A pilot hole may be needed depending on the material thickness, screw size, and installation method. Using the correct pilot hole can help the screw form threads properly, reduce splitting in wood, and make installation easier in tougher materials.

Sheet Metal Screws vs Machine Screws

Sheet metal screws are designed to create or cut mating threads in a prepared hole or compatible material. Machine screws are designed for use with pre-existing machine threads, such as a tapped hole, threaded insert, or matching nut.

Choose sheet metal screws when the screw needs to form threads in the material during installation. Choose machine screws when the application already has matching internal threads or will use a nut.

316 Stainless Steel Phillips Truss Head Sheet Metal Screw FAQs

What is a 316 stainless steel Phillips truss head sheet metal screw?

A 316 stainless steel Phillips truss head sheet metal screw is a self-tapping screw with a Phillips drive, 316 stainless steel construction, and a wide low-profile truss head.

What are 316 stainless steel truss head sheet metal screws used for?

They are used for sheet metal panels, brackets, covers, fixtures, enclosures, marine hardware, outdoor equipment, HVAC work, appliance repair, automotive trim, plastic, fiberglass, wood, and general maintenance applications.

What is the benefit of a truss head screw?

A truss head screw provides a wide bearing surface with a relatively low profile. This can help spread clamping pressure across thin material, panels, brackets, or covers.

Are 316 stainless steel sheet metal screws good for marine use?

Yes. 316 stainless steel is commonly selected for marine, coastal, wet, and corrosive environments because it offers stronger corrosion resistance than general-purpose stainless steel.

Do truss head sheet metal screws sit flush?

No. Truss head sheet metal screws have a low-profile raised head. For a flush installation, use a flat head or oval head screw with a properly countersunk hole.

What is the difference between 316 and 18-8 stainless steel sheet metal screws?

316 stainless steel provides greater corrosion resistance than 18-8 stainless steel in many marine, coastal, chemical, and harsh environments. 18-8 stainless steel is still commonly used for general indoor and outdoor fastening.

What is the difference between truss head and pan head sheet metal screws?

Truss head sheet metal screws have a wider, lower-profile head, while pan head sheet metal screws have a smaller rounded head with a flat underside.
